So what did I make…? Fried chicken and pumpkin waffle tacos!

Fried Chicken and Pumpkin Waffle TacosChicken and waffles are already a majorly delicious breakfast (lunch or dinner) staple, but I wanted to step them up a notch by turning them into a taco. Because, why not? (They just seem like so much more fun that way, don’t they?)

And you might think that adding pumpkin to a normal chicken and waffles combination might be a little weird, but the flavors are so complimentary to each other and perfect for Fall too.

The recipe is really easy to make and so tasty too!

Fried Chicken and Pumpkin Waffle TacosHere’s what you’ll need to make your own:

  • Fried Chicken Strips
  • Waffle Batter
  • 1 cup Pumpkin Puree
  • 1 Tsp. Pumpkin Pie Spice
  • Maple Syrup
  • Hot Sauce (Optional)

I chose to make my own chicken strips, using a pouch of the seasoned crispy chicken fry chicken batter mix from Louisiana Fish Fry products (available at the local grocery store), but you can use any homemade recipe or store bought strips that you prefer.

Prepare your chicken strips, if needed, and set aside.

For waffles, I go the really easy route and use boxed mix. It’s so easy and they know what they’re doing, so why mess with perfection?

To make the waffles a little more seasonally appropriate, add in one cup of pumpkin puree and 1 tsp. of pumpkin pie spice to your batter. Mix well, before pouring onto your waffle iron.

As soon as your waffles are done, fold them into a “taco” shape as soon as they come off of the hot iron.

Fried Chicken and Pumpkin Waffle TacosPlace your chicken strips inside your waffle shell and then top the chicken with warm maple syrup. (If you want to kick your syrup up a notch, add 1/4 cup of your favorite hot sauce to 1 cup of maple syrup).
